Verse in context β Deuteronomy 14
8
The pig, because it has a split hoof but doesn't chew the cud, is unclean to you: of their flesh you shall not eat, and their carcasses you shall not touch.
9
These you may eat of all that are in the waters: whatever has fins and scales may you eat;
10
and whatever doesn't have fins and scales you shall not eat; it is unclean to you.
11
Of all clean birds you may eat.
12
But these are they of which you shall not eat: the eagle, and the vulture, and the osprey,
